CRYSTAL STRUCTURE OF MICROPLASMINOGEN-STREPTOKINASE ALPHA DOMAIN COMPLEX

Reaction catalysed:
Preferential cleavage: Lys-|-Xaa > Arg-|-Xaa, higher selectivity than trypsin. Converts fibrin into soluble products.

Macromolecules (2 distinct):
Plasmin light chain B Chain: A
Molecule details ›
Chain: A
Length: 249 amino acids
Theoretical weight: 27.25 KDa
Source organism: Homo sapiens
Expression system: Escherichia coli BL21
UniProt:
  • Canonical: P00747 (Residues: 562-810; Coverage: 32%)
Gene name: PLG
Sequence domains: Trypsin
Structure domains: Trypsin-like serine proteases
Streptokinase C Chain: B
Molecule details ›
Chain: B
Length: 122 amino acids
Theoretical weight: 13.46 KDa
Source organism: Streptococcus dysgalactiae subsp. equisimilis
Expression system: Escherichia coli BL21
UniProt:
  • Canonical: P00779 (Residues: 40-173; Coverage: 30%)
Gene name: skc
Sequence domains: Staphylokinase/Streptokinase family
Structure domains: Ubiquitin-like (UB roll)
